Gerald R. Ford Museum
Take a holographic tour of Ford’s White House and see a piece of the Berlin Wall in this tribute to the 38th president in the town where he was raised.

Grand Rapids Art Museum
The sleek design of the modernist building reflects the gorgeous contemporary artworks within. Learn how to make art fun in the workshops and camps.
